McCleskey v. Kemp, Superintendent, Georgia Diagnostic and Classification Center
Decided April 22, 1987. Lewis Franklin Powell Jr. delivered the opinion of the Court.
Docket 84-6811 · 481 U.S. 279 (1987) · Cited 2,038 times
We don’t yet publish a summary of this opinion — read the official text below for the Court’s holding and reasoning.
How the Justices voted
Decided 5–4.
Majority · 5
- Lewis Franklin Powell Jr. · delivered the opinion of the Court
- Antonin Scalia
- Byron Raymond White
- Sandra Day O'Connor
- William Hubbs Rehnquist
Dissenting · 4
- Harry Andrew Blackmun · filed a dissenting opinion
- John Paul Stevens · filed a dissenting opinion
- Thurgood Marshall
- William Joseph Brennan Jr. · filed a dissenting opinion
